Hey folks. Really appreciate all the feedback.

Wanted to clarify this really is simply an experiment. We wanted to see what effect changing the duration (in this case, lengthening it) would have (on total sales, on our creator partners’ timelines, etc.)

There’ll be more experiments coming soon as well (some similar to what many of you have recommended)

I’ll try to keep a better on this thread (and other feedback threads) but always feel free to mention me directly/pm me/or message on discord/twitter

Edit: Oh and expect a return to 24hr features immediately after Epistory : )

I agree with those saying the rotation should stay fixed at 24 hours with the possibility of ‘feature duration’ from game to game being less rigid.
I would add, however, that any given game shouldn’t be able to be featured longer than a set hard cap. If the title is downright amazing AND Chrono.GG has an absolutely ludicrous stock of copies to sell, I could see one feature lasting up to 30 days (1 month) and no longer without disrupting the normal operation and traffic of the site, provided these ‘30 day features’ don’t become a habit.
At any given time, I could potentially see a maximum of 7 ‘features’ going on concurrently, INCLUDING whatever game is to be dropped into the 24 hour rotation. So, for example, if six games were already in an ‘extended feature period’ and the time rolls around for another game to be featured, then one of the current features would HAVE to expire before another game could be added. If it should occur that 7 games are being featured, AND it comes time to feature another title, BUT none of the current features are going to expire in time, the next feature would have to be postponed until another ‘slot’ opens up, with no effect to that feature’s planned duration. This would allow the possibility of a backup to occur, which would force the Chrono staff to utilize extended features wisely.
